Jo Joyner praises 'EastEnders' live ep
Published Tuesday, Mar 2 2010, 12:02 GMT | By Daniel Kilkelly

The actress, who plays Walford's Tanya Branning, did not feature in last month's special instalment as she is currently on maternity leave, but she attended the show's Elstree Studios base to watch a screening of the broadcast on the night.
EastEnders' live transmission marked the programme's 25th anniversary and focused on Bradley (Charlie Clements), Max (Jake Wood) and Stacey Branning (Lacey Turner) as the Archie Mitchell murder mystery reached a climax.
Speaking to What's On TV, Joyner commented: "The atmosphere was just fantastic and I was so proud of them all. I was so proud of my boys especially - the Branning boys, I thought they were wonderful, and Lacey.
"I just thought they were all fantastic, and the crew - you don't see them all running about. We had nine units and all the cameramen everywhere. The whole thing was such a team effort and really special."
The star, who gave birth to twins in January, admitted that she was "truly gutted" to miss out on taking part in the episode.
However, she added: "We knew it was coming for a long time and I was pregnant for a long time, so I knew that I couldn't be involved with it.
"But that's why I went along for the screening - to not be involved and then to not be involved at all would have been awful. But to be part of the atmosphere on the night was fantastic."
